WebJun 21, 2024 · Play. Some numbers that end in 0 are written with the ending ‘-enta,’ such as 30 (treinta). The exceptions to this rule are the numbers 10 (diez) and 20 (veinte). From the number 30 onwards, it becomes even easier to count. As you stop combining the words’ veinti+nueve’ – 29, start separating and adding a ‘y’ (and). WebJan 22, 2024 · Spanish Terms of Arithmetic Here are the words for the simple mathematical functions and how they're used with numbers : Addition (Suma): Dos más tres son cinco. (Two plus three is five.) Note that in other contexts, más is usually an adverb . Subtraction (Resta): Cinco menos cuatro son uno. (Five minus four is one.)

eastern gateway community college codeWebThe Spanish numbers uno and veintiuno are apocopated (shortened) when they are right before a noun, adjective or another numeral. Then they become un y veintiún, respectively: Some numerals have specifically feminine forms.
